Russian set for space golf shot
taken from the BBC website
Quote:
A Russian cosmonaut is set to make golfing history when he tees off from a precarious perch outside the International Space Station (ISS).
Flight engineer Mikhail Tyurin will stand on a ladder by the docking port and hit a light-weight ball using a gold-plated six-iron club.
A Canadian golf club maker is paying the Russian space agency an undisclosed sum for the stunt.
Experts disagree on how far the ball will travel in space.
Sponsor Element 21 Golf says it will fly for 3 years, while NASA says it will more likely fall into the earth's atmosphere and burn up within three days
Mr Tyurin, who has only played golf twice in his life, was confident ahead of the spacewalk.
"I play ice hockey and my understanding is that it is very similar," he said.
He will tap the ball, which is one-tenth the weight of a normal golf ball, using only one arm due to the confines of the bulky space suit.
Station commander Michael Lopez-Alegria, who is accompanying Mr Tyurin, will set up a camera to film the shot for a forthcoming television commercial.
The stunt is one of several that the Russian space agency has permitted as a way of raising money.
Pizza Hut has been allowed to put its logo on a rocket and paying tourists have been brought to the station.
The plan was stalled for months while NASA - barred by US law from raising private funding - made sure the ball would not come back and hit the station.
But NASA flight director Holly Ridings said it was safe. "There is absolutely no re-contact issue with the space station," she said.
Although a likely record breaker in terms of distance, it will not be the first golf stroke in space.
US astronaut Alan Shepard took a shot while on the surface of the moon as commander of Apollo 14 in 1971
